Objectives of the Course

Improving and performing of optimum catching technique in order to utilize of aquatic products. Obtain basic principles of fishing methods and gears applicable to inland and seawater fisheries

Course Content

Teaching of net design with fundamentals and applications. Net types. Traps, hooks and lines, grappling and wounding gears, stupefying devices. Application areas of fishing gears.
